Whole wheat flour is produced from processed wheat grains. It has a sweet, nutty taste and is slightly dark in color. The main composition of whole wheat flour includes minerals, dietary fibers, vitamins, starch, and carbohydrates. It also has a moderate amount of protein, contributing to its many benefits.

2. Improves digestion

Whole wheat grain is rich in fiber. This composition gives whole wheat flour a multidimensional effect on the body. In addition to helping digestion, it also assists in getting rid of harmful toxins from the body.

3. Helps with weight control

Whole wheat flour helps with weight control

Research shows that consuming fiber-rich food can lower the risk of obesity and help in weight loss. According to studies, whole wheat grains help reduce lousy fat. It also helps in distributing it in the body.

Additionally, it is believed that an individual’s body mass index (BMI) will be lowered when they consume meals containing whole wheat grain three times a day.

5. Rich in fiber and nutrient

Whole wheat flour is rich in fiber and nutrient

Whole wheat flour is packed with sufficient amounts of proteins, zinc, magnesium, fibers, and vitamins. Zinc is also present in high content in whole wheat flour. Vitamin B is another nutrient that whole wheat flour is a rich source of.

In addition to the antioxidants in whole wheat flour, other minerals include iron and manganese.

7. Reduces the risk of heart disease

Consuming whole wheat grain lowers your risk of developing heart disease. This is the maximum benefit whole wheat flour has on the body.
According to some studies, having three meals containing whole grains is good for heart health. Also, heart health is better maintained with a whole-grain diet than refined grains.
